Arthur Fleck, who later takes on the persona of "Joker," is a man who struggles with social awkwardness and mental health issues while working as a clown-for-hire.

He faces personal challenges such as an unsupportive and neglectful mother and a society that appears indifferent to his struggles.

To escape his reality, he dreams of becoming a stand-up comedian and idolizes a popular late-night talk show host named Murray Franklin.

However, Arthur's fantasies often blur with reality, leaving him unsure of what is real and what is not.
